频 道 直 达 - 新闻 - 培训 - 软件 - 教程 - 前沿 - 组网 - 系统应用 - 安全 - 编程 - 存储 - 操作系统 - 数据库 - 服务器 - 专题 - 产品 - 案例库 - 读书 - 博客 - BBS
51CTO.COM_中国最大的网络技术网站
找资料:

RESTful Web Services中文版 目录

作者: Leonard Richardson 、 Sam Ruby/徐涵李、红军、胡伟. 出处:电子工业出版社  2008-05-09 12:53    砖    好    评论   进入论坛
阅读提示:《RESTful Web Services中文版》本书向读者介绍了什么是REST、什么是面向资源的架构(Resource-Oriented Architecture,ROA)、REST式设计的优点、REST式Web服务的真实案例分析、如何用各种流行的编程语言编写Web服务客户端、如何用三种流行的框架(Ruby on Rails、Restlet和Django)实现REST式服务等,本节为目录部分。

目录


序 I
前言 III
第1章:Programmable Web及其分类 1
Programmable Web的分类 4
HTTP:信封里的文档 5
方法信息 8
作用域信息 11
相互竞争的服务架构 13
Programmable Web涉及的技术 18
其他术语 20
第2章:编写Web服务客户端 23
Web服务就是网站 23
del.icio.us:示例应用 26
用HTTP库发送请求 29
用XML解析器处理响应 38
JSON Parsers:处理序列化数据 44
WADL简化客户端的编写 47
第3章:REST式服务有什么特别不同? 49
介绍Simple Storage Service 49
S3的面向对象设计 50
资源 52
HTTP响应代码 54
一个S3客户端 55
对请求进行签名及访问控制 64
使用S3客户端库 70
用ActiveResource创建透明的客户端 71
最后的话 77

第4章:面向资源的架构 79
面向资源的架构? 79
什么是资源? 81
URIs 81
可寻址性 84
无状态性 86
表示 91
链接与连通性 94
统一接口 97
结束了! 105
第5章:设计只读的面向资源的服务 107
资源设计 108
根据需求创建只读资源 109
规划数据集 110
把数据集划分为资源 112
命名资源 117
设计表示 123
把资源相互链接起来 135
HTTP响应 137
小结 140
第6章:设计可读写的面向资源的服务 143
将用户账户作为资源 144
自定义地点 157
回顾地图服务 165
第7章:一个服务实现 167
一个社会性书签Web服务 167
规划数据集 168
资源设计 171
设计来自客户端的表示 183
设计发给客户端的表示 184
把资源相互链接起来 185
会有哪些典型的事件经过? 186
可能出现哪些错误情况? 187
控制器代码 188
模型代码 205
客户端需要知道什么? 209
第8章:REST和ROA最佳实践 215
面向资源的基础 215

一般的ROA设计步骤 216
可寻址性 216
状态与无状态性 217
连通性 218
统一接口 218
一些重要方面 221
资源设计 227
URI设计 233
返回的表示 234
收到的表示 234
服务的版本化 235
永久URIs vs可读的URIs 236
HTTP的标准特性 237
仿造PUT和DELETE 251
Cookies的问题 252
用户凭什么信任HTTP客户端? 253
第9章:服务的技术构件 259
表示格式 259
预定义的控制流 272
超媒体技术 284
第10章:面向资源的架构VS大Web服务 299
大Web服务试图解决哪些问题? 300
SOAP 300
WSDL 304
UDDI 309
安全性 310
可靠消息传递 311
事务 312
BPEL、ESB和SOA 313
小结 314
第11章:将Ajax应用作为REST客户端 315
从AJAX到Ajax 315
Ajax架构 316
一个del.icio.us示例 317
Ajax的优点 320
Ajax的缺点 320
REST更好 322
发送请求 323
处理响应 324
JSON 325

不要私享REST的好处 326
跨浏览器问题和Ajax库 327
颠覆浏览器安全模型 331
第12章:REST式服务框架 339
Ruby on Rails 339
Restlet 343
Django 354
小结 364
附录A:REST相关资源与REST式资源 365
标准与指南 365
你可以使用的服务 367
附录B:42种常见的HTTP响应代码 371
三至七种最基本的响应代码 372
1xx:通知 373
2xx:成功 374
3xx:重定向 377
4xx:客户端错误 380
5xx:服务器端错误 387
附录C:常见的HTTP报头 389
标准报头 390
非标准报头 404
索引

【责任编辑:夏书 TEL:(010)68476606】

回书目      
专题
企业Web安全威胁在线评估系统
Web 2.0基础知识大全
Websphere入门
Windows活动目录服务应用
征服Ajax+Lucene构建搜索引擎
我也说两句

匿名发表

(如果看不清请点击图片进行更换)


中 国 最 大 的 网 络 技 术 网 站 ·
技 术 成 就 梦 想
订阅技术快讯
电子杂志下载
名称:SQL Server数据库管理精品黄皮书
简介:书中文章经过精挑细选,便于用户能根据自己的实际工作和学习,快速在本书寻找到相关资料。内容涵盖了SQL Server的安装与升级、语句查询、数据备份和恢复、自动化任务、数据同步、数据字典、安全和预防、性能和优化、集群等各方面应用信息,以及DBA管理人员在数据库管理工作中
名称:2007路由技术大全
简介:《2007路由技术大全》由51CTO.com网站特别策划制作,该书包括路由器技术、路由器产品、路由器配置、安全设置、路由器故障处理、路由器密码恢复,以及广大网友在实践使用中的心得经验和技巧文章,内容注重实用性,适用于初学者入门,也适合多年从业者提高,是一本实践和理论完
名称:网络安全精品应用黄皮书
简介:《2007精品网络安全黄皮书》包括了9个大类24个小类, 800余篇文章,内容包含了熊猫烧香病毒、DDOS攻击、ARP病等热点问题的介绍及解决方案。从病毒查杀、防范、系统、数据等各方面的安全设置到黑客技术的了解、防范,涉及到了安全应用的全部领域, 由浅至深内容全面。
LAMP技术精解
LAMP技术精解
微软出价446亿美元收购雅虎
微软出价446亿美元收购雅虎
网络故障排除宝典
网络故障排除宝典
· 网络故障排除宝典
· Vista SP1对决XP SP3
· 华为路由器配置
· 2008年上半年全国软考..
· AIX操作系统管理应用(..
· 华为员工自杀频频拷问..
· 三层交换技术专题
· ARP攻击防范与解决方案
· 隐私保护技术探讨
· 反垃圾邮件技术应用
· 龙芯要做中国的“奔腾”
· Windows Server 2008专..
· AMD Phenom三核处理器..
· 路由器设置与口令恢复
· 微软Forefront企业安全..
· 企业数据恢复指南
ARP攻击防范与解决方案
ARP攻击防范与解决方案
iSCSI应用与发展
iSCSI应用与发展
SQL Server 2008/2005全解
SQL Server 2008/2005全解
· SQL Server 2008/2005..
· SOA 面向服务架构
· SQL Server 2008/2005..
· iSCSI应用与发展
· RAID——磁盘阵列基础
· Apache技术专题
· 中间件应用技术专题
· 三层交换技术专题
· SQL Server入门到精通
· Apache技术专题
· 国际文档格式标准开战
· 路由器设置与口令恢复
· 打造安全服务器
· PHP开发应用手册
· SOA 面向服务架构
· 企业数据恢复指南
ARP攻击防范与解决方案
ARP攻击防范与解决方案
SQL Server 2008/2005全解
SQL Server 2008/2005全解
iSCSI应用与发展
iSCSI应用与发展
· iSCSI应用与发展
· 中间件应用技术专题
· SQL Server入门到精通
· SQL Server 2008/2005..
· SOA 面向服务架构
· Apache技术专题
· iSCSI应用与发展
· 三层交换技术专题
· Apache技术专题
· 企业数据恢复指南
· RAID——磁盘阵列基础
· 路由器设置与口令恢复
· SOA 面向服务架构
· ADSL应用面面俱到
· ADSL应用面面俱到
· 反垃圾邮件技术应用